India Tightens Security for NEET-UG Exam with Multi-Layered Measures

The Ministry of Education implements robust protocols, including police escorts and monitoring of coaching centers, to ensure the integrity of the May 4 medical entrance exam.

The Ministry has been working on a fool-proof plan following alleged irregularities in last year's exam, including paper leaks, which put the exam integrity under scanner.

Overview

  • The NEET-UG exam, scheduled for May 4, will take place across 550 cities and over 5,000 centers in India.
  • Confidential exam materials such as question papers and OMR sheets will be transported under full police escort to prevent leaks.
  • Multi-layered frisking by district police, alongside NTA-designated security, will be conducted at examination centers.
  • Coaching centers and digital platforms are being closely monitored to thwart organized cheating networks.
  • District Magistrates, Superintendents of Police, and Duty Magistrates are conducting inspections and overseeing preparations to ensure fair conduct.
